Manchester United Women midfielder Lucy Staniforth has sealed a move to Aston Villa, the club have confirmed.

The England international has joined the Midlands club on an eighteen-month contract, having spent the last two and a half years at Old Trafford.

Staniforth actually signed from Villa’s rivals Birmingham City in 2020 and she went on to make 41 appearances for the Red Devils, scoring three goals in the process.


The 30-year-old was part of the England side that won the 2020 SheBelieves Cup. She was also included in the squad for the 2019 Women’s World Cup.

It is believed that United are lining up a potential replacement for Staniforth, having been linked with a £160,000 bid for Norway international Lisa Naalsund only last week.

With Staniforth having less than six months remaining on her contract anyway, her departure does seem like good business, especially if she was no longer a key part of Marc Skinner’s first-team plans.
